一、核心需求分析
1. 自动化结算场景
- 供应商货款结算(按订单、周期或批次)
- 客户应收账款管理(账期、预付款、分期结算)
- 平台手续费自动计算(佣金、服务费)
- 异常订单处理(退货、扣款、争议)
2. 关键痛点
- 人工对账耗时易错
- 结算周期长,资金周转慢
- 多角色(供应商、客户、平台)财务数据割裂
- 缺乏实时财务数据支持决策
二、系统架构设计
1. 模块划分
- 订单管理模块
- 实时同步生鲜采购、销售订单数据(数量、价格、时间)
- 自动关联物流信息(签收、拒收、损耗)
- 财务核算模块
- 规则引擎:配置结算公式(如“结算金额=订单金额-退货金额-平台佣金”)
- 多维度核算:按供应商、客户、商品类别、时间周期统计
- 异常处理:自动标记需人工审核的订单(如价格争议、退货纠纷)
- 支付对接模块
- 集成第三方支付(微信、支付宝、银联)和银行接口
- 支持批量打款、自动扣款、账期提醒
- 数据中台
- 统一存储订单、物流、财务数据,确保数据一致性
- 提供API接口供外部系统(如ERP、税务系统)调用
2. 技术选型
- 后端:Spring Cloud/Dubbo(微服务架构)
- 数据库:MySQL(关系型数据)+ MongoDB(日志/非结构化数据)
- 中间件:RabbitMQ/Kafka(异步消息处理)
- 规则引擎:Drools(动态结算规则配置)
- 大数据:Flink/Spark(实时财务分析)
三、核心功能实现
1. 自动对账与结算
- 步骤:
1. 数据抓取:从订单系统、WMS(仓储系统)、TMS(物流系统)同步数据。
2. 规则匹配:根据预设规则(如“签收后3天无退货自动结算”)触发结算流程。
3. 异常检测:对比订单金额、物流签收状态、退货记录,标记差异项。
4. 自动生成凭证:对接财务系统(如用友、金蝶)生成应收/应付凭证。
- 示例规则:
```plaintext
IF 订单状态=已完成 AND 退货数量=0 AND 当前时间>签收时间+3天
THEN 生成结算单(金额=订单金额-平台佣金5%)
```
2. 供应商结算
- 周期结算:按周/月汇总供应商订单,自动计算应付款。
- 预付款管理:支持供应商预付款抵扣,实时更新余额。
- 扣款管理:自动扣除质量罚款、滞纳金等(如“损耗率>3%扣款10%”)。
3. 客户账期管理
- 灵活账期:支持按客户等级设置账期(如VIP客户30天,普通客户15天)。
- 预收款核销:客户预付款自动抵扣后续订单金额。
- 逾期提醒:账期到期前3天发送短信/邮件提醒。
4. 财务分析与报表
- 实时看板:展示应收账款、应付账款、现金流等关键指标。
- 多维报表:按供应商、客户、商品类别生成结算明细表。
- 异常预警:监控结算延迟、金额异常等情况。
四、实施步骤
1. 需求梳理:与财务、采购、销售部门确认结算规则和流程。
2. 系统对接:打通订单、仓储、物流系统数据接口。
3. 规则配置:在系统中配置结算公式、账期、扣款规则等。
4. 测试验证:模拟真实场景测试自动结算准确性。
5. 上线培训:对财务、供应商、客户进行系统操作培训。
6. 迭代优化:根据反馈调整规则,优化异常处理流程。
五、风险控制
- 数据安全:加密传输财务数据,权限分级管理。
- 审计追踪:记录所有结算操作日志,支持追溯。
- 容灾备份:定期备份数据,确保系统高可用。
- 合规性:符合税务法规(如增值税发票自动匹配)。
六、案例参考
- 美团快驴进货:通过自动化结算将供应商结算周期从7天缩短至2天,人工对账成本降低60%。
- 每日优鲜:集成银行直连支付,实现T+1日自动打款,供应商满意度提升40%。
总结
快驴生鲜系统实现财务自动结算的核心是数据贯通+规则引擎+支付集成。通过技术手段将重复性工作自动化,不仅能提升效率,还能减少人为错误,为生鲜供应链的快速周转提供财务保障。实施时需重点关注规则配置的灵活性和异常处理的闭环设计。